这个截图有点类似下载的那种,可以按照自己的需要在代码中指定要截屏的部分,点击截图会
原创
2021-12-30 13:35:13
1659阅读
\src\components\Wave.vue <template> <div :style="{ height: waveAllHeight + 'px', background: bgColor }" class="wave"> <canvas id="wave1"></canvas> <ca ...
转载
2021-09-09 17:20:00
423阅读
2评论
1.安装npm i vue-canvas-nest//如果使用淘宝镜像的话cnpm i vue-canvas-nest//或者yarnyarn
原创
2022-10-28 08:38:45
95阅读
1、vue父子组件传值方式1、props
2、v-model
3、.sync 父组件向子组件传的值,子组件可以直接修改父组件的值
4、ref
父组件通过ref直接拿到子组件的属性或方法
5、$emit
父组件给子组件定义事件,子组件中emit触发,参数(事件名,参数)
6、$children&$parent
获取到一个包含所有子组件的对象数组,直接拿到父子组件的属性和方法
转载
2024-07-19 14:34:02
96阅读
前言使用【sign-canvas】组件二次封装自定义手写签名组件,一个基于canvas开发封装实现的通用手写签名板(电子签名板),支持PC端和移动端,效果如
原创
2022-01-12 15:14:41
985阅读
vue 使用 html2canvas 截取图片保存 好久没有写博文了,写够了,没啥想写的了,这个号算是废了,哎
原创
2023-12-26 16:53:15
304阅读
1.代码<template> <div class="test" style="background-color: burlywood;"> <canvas id="myCanvas" ref="myCanvas"
原创
2022-09-27 11:53:29
333阅读
这次做了个项目,其中一个模块的功能就是,根据用户填写的信息生成一个pdf但是pdf有很多表格,而且格式比较复杂,如果用代码写出这种模板,然后将当前页面生成pdf这种方法显然不太现实,后来发现用填充模板的方法可以实现1.先安装对应依赖npm install docxtemplater pizzip --save-dev
npm install jszip-utils --save
npm insta
转载
2024-08-11 10:46:33
61阅读
一:KEYCLOAK配置部分: 1,下载keycloak,官网地址:https://www.keycloak.org/downloads.html。下载第一个就行 2,下载完毕之后,打开文件,访问 bin 路径,点击 standalone.bat 打开,打开之后大概如下: 3,然后访问:http://localhost:8080/auth/ ,下
转载
2024-01-10 18:58:35
245阅读
使用Vue、Canvas、ElementUI实现的电子签字版,PC和移动端皆可用。效果如下: HTML <template> <section class="signature"> <div class="signatureBox"> <div class="canvasBox" ref="canv ...
转载
2021-09-14 11:01:00
422阅读
点赞
2评论
在现代前端开发中,Vue.js 是一个极其流行的 JavaScript 框架,而 Yarn 则是一个高效的包管理工具。把这两者结合使用,可以带来更好的开发体验。然而,在这个过程中,我们也可能会遇到一些技术痛点。
### 背景定位
在 Vue 项目的早期开发中,团队面临着以下技术痛点:
> “我们希望能够快速搭建 Vue 项目,同时希望依赖包管理更高效,解决传统的 npm install 速度
作者:瑞哥最近 Vue3 关于 ref-sugar 的提案引起了广泛的讨论:juejin.im/post/689417…[1]<script setup>
import Foo from './Foo.vue'
// declaring a variable that compiles to a ref
ref: count = 1
const inc = () => {
文章目录基本使用步骤指令的概念内容渲染指令属性绑定指令事件绑定指令事件修饰符按键修饰符双向绑定指令条件渲染指令列表渲染指令 基本使用步骤1.导入vue.js的script脚本文件(可在官网下载)vue官网 2.在页面中声明一个将要被vue所控制的DOM区域 3.创建vm实例对象(vue的实例对象)<!DOCTYPE html>
<html lang="en">
<h
文章目录一、环境二、创建项目三、启动项目四、项目结构与解释 一、环境环境已经搭好,所以就不废话了,看一下我的版本 这已经是最新环境了。二、创建项目我们使用命令vue create创建,如下:vue create v1 提示说:请选择一个预设,预设就是项目的一些初始化,就是给你安装规定一些基本的东西,以前的低版本vue创建项目是用vue init webpack 【projectName] 命令,
转载
2024-04-19 14:38:30
41阅读
Echarts 官网:http://echarts.apache.org/zh/index.html 安装依赖 npm安装 npm install echarts -S 或者用淘宝镜像安装 npm install -g cnpm --registry=https://registry.npm.tao ...
转载
2021-10-27 18:47:00
222阅读
2评论
1,使用save会在package.json中自动添加。 注: 通常使用npm安装会出现以下报错,安装失败。(网路问题) 可以通过淘宝的npm镜像安装node-sass,解决以上问题。 $ npm install -g cnpm --registry=https://registry.npm.tao
转载
2017-03-11 15:45:00
163阅读
2评论
https://www.jianshu.com/p/5c4bde800762
转载
2022-06-13 17:00:24
47阅读
颜色合成 globalCompositeOperation 属性:?1234567891011//先绘制一个图形。ctx.fillStyle = "#00ff00";ctx.fillRect(10,10,50,50);//设置 lobalCompositeOperation 属性。ctx.globa...
转载
2015-04-02 09:44:00
86阅读
2评论
文章目录一、canvas在移动端自适应大小canvas坑1:设置canvas的css的宽高会导致你的填充内容被拉伸canvas坑1解决办法:解决后的代码与效果
原创
2022-01-18 10:55:17
236阅读
文章目录一、canvas在移动端自适应大小canvas坑1:设置canvas的css的宽高会导致你的填充内容被拉伸canvas坑1解决办法:解决后的代码与效果如下:canvas坑2:不能设置css属性如何让它自适应?canvas坑2解决办法:二、设置背景色,画填充色三、填充字体、设置字体大小、粗体、颜色、文本X,Y轴居中对齐canvas坑3:设置完背景色设置文字失败?四、canvas填充字体模糊的...
原创
2021-06-18 18:23:37
770阅读